THOMAS J. ORR, Company "D"


     THOMAS J. ORR, the son of Thomas and Nancy (Frazier) Orr, was born about 1840 in Ohio County, and died in that county 11 Apr 1911. His wife was Sarah "Sallie" Oldham, whom he married 6 Mar 1867 in Ohio County.

From Service Record: He enlisted 14 Aug 1864 at West Liberty, Ohio County, (W) Va., and mustered in at Wheeling 25 Aug 1862. On detached service as clerk at Division Headquarters, Harper's Ferry, beginning December 2, 1863 per order of General Sullivan. On July 27/29, 1864, General Crook/Colonel Joseph Thoburn ordered Thomas J. Orr to serve at the Department/Division Headquarters. Mustered out 16 June 1865 at Richmond.

The soldier applied for a government pension in March 1891, and received Pension Certificate #707.251. Following his death, his widow also applied for and received a pension.

1880 Census, Ohio County, West Virginia
Thomas Orr, 40, Farmer, b WV, parents b WV
Sarah J., Wife, At home, b WV, parents b WV
Frank D., 12, Son, Works on Farm, b WV
Nettie R., 10, Dau, At home, b WV
Cordie [Cordelia] E., 9, Dau, b WV
Mary, 7 Dau, b WV
Thomas W., 1, Son, b WV

About 1901, they had a daughter Margaret "Maggie" who married George N. Richardson in June 1902.
